About Propshop Events and Exhibitions Limited

Propshop Events and Exhibitions Limited is an event management and experiential marketing company providing end-to-end solutions for businesses, brands, organisations, and institutions.

The company specialises in creating customised events based on client requirements, including concept development, planning, designing, production, execution, and post-event management.

Its integrated approach allows clients to manage multiple event requirements through a single service provider, improving efficiency and ensuring consistent execution quality.

 

Business Model

Propshop Events and Exhibitions follows a project-based service model supported by long-term client relationships.

Its major business activities include:

  • Corporate event management
  • Exhibition planning and execution
  • Brand activation campaigns
  • Product launch events
  • Corporate conferences
  • Trade fairs
  • Promotional activities
  • Stage and venue management
  • Event production services
  • Audio-visual solutions
  • Creative design services

The company earns revenue through project contracts, event execution fees, production services, and customised marketing solutions.

 

Service Portfolio

The company provides a wide range of event and exhibition-related services.

Its key offerings include:

Corporate Events

Planning and managing business conferences, seminars, annual meetings, and corporate celebrations.

Exhibitions and Trade Shows

Designing exhibition stalls, managing event infrastructure, and providing complete exhibition solutions.

Brand Activation

Creating interactive marketing campaigns that improve customer engagement and brand recognition.

Product Launches

Managing promotional events designed to create awareness and market excitement around new products.

Experiential Marketing

Developing creative experiences that connect brands with their target audiences.

Event Production

Providing technical arrangements including lighting, sound, stage setup, and production management.

 

Client Segments

Propshop Events and Exhibitions serves clients across multiple industries.

Major customer segments include:

  • Corporate companies
  • Consumer brands
  • Real estate companies
  • Healthcare organisations
  • Educational institutions
  • Technology companies
  • Government organisations
  • Hospitality businesses
  • Retail brands

A diversified customer base helps the company reduce dependency on a single industry.

Key Risk Factors

Like every service-based business, Propshop Events and Exhibitions faces certain operational challenges.

Project-Based Revenue

Revenue may fluctuate depending on event schedules and contract availability.

Seasonal Demand

Certain periods may experience higher event activity compared with others.

Competition

The event management industry includes several established and regional players.

Vendor Dependency

Successful execution depends on reliable third-party vendors and service partners.

Economic Conditions

Corporate spending on events may reduce during economic slowdowns.

Investors should carefully evaluate these risks before making an investment decision.
